New Guy from SC
Hi ya'll, I have a real mixed bag vehicle. It is a 1952 3100 pick-up. It has a camaro suspension and a 1970 400 SBC with 1989 5.7 heads, intake, TBI, ECM and surpentine drive. Tranny is a 700R4 and 10 bolt rear. Interior has Camaro pedals steering wheel and seats all the rest 1952 stuff. I'll be needing help I know so glad to know ya'll will be here.

HP estimate
The 400 was originally 260 HP, but the change to swirl port heads and a 480 CFM TBI isn't helping any, so with the headers I'm guessing 240? I researching the possibility of a big block TBI swap for more power, but without upgrading the heads that would probably help less than stellar. Any suggestions.
#4
Might try a carb manifold w/ a Q-jet. Got to be better than a restrictive TBI. Not sure what the valve size is on those heads but could but some big valve heads on it and headers. From there you're probably talking cam and pistons.
